JF1361: A Syndicator Just Found an Apartment Deal…Now What? Part 1 of 3 #FollowAlongFriday with Joe and Theo

As a syndicator and passive investor, it is important to know what to do once you find a deal. Today Joe and Theo explain the first parts of the due diligence process with apartment communities. For passive investors, you’ll want to know what your sponsor has done and see their findings in the due diligence as well as see their business plan for the apartment community. As a syndicator of apartment communities, it is important to not only perform the due diligence, but also be able to effectively communicate what you found to your passive investors. JF1358: Relationship Based Lending For Long Term Partners with Ramon Gonzalez

Ramon got his start in real estate when he left the corporate world to be an entrepreneur. A large part of his success he can attribute to being able to identify what he is good at and sticking to where he is wanted. After multifamily investing in Miami didn’t work for him, Ramon tried the fix and flip model. Ultimately neither strategy was fulfilling, now he lends money to active investors, and loves it. Hear what he looks for before lending to an investor and why being able to put your ego aside and focus on your strengths is key to being a successful entrepreneur. JF1357: Identify An Emerging Part Of A Down Market, Invest, & Make Money with Brent Maxwell

Brent is an investor in Detroit, MI. That’s right, Brent invests in, makes money, and helps other investors make money in Detroit. The trick is finding emerging neighborhoods before they become “hip”. We may focus the conversation on Detroit today, but a lot of these tactics are applicable across the country.
